We can’t evaluate a deal based on the payment alone. Here’s what you need to know if you’re getting a fair deal:

  1. MSRP
  2. Selling Price - Is there a discount, no discount, or a mark-up?
  3. Money Factor - Is it the buy rate, or are they marking it up?
  4. Incentives included in the deal
  5. Breakdown at the fees

If the dealer won’t provide you those details, then create a target deal to shoot for using the Leasehackr Calculator.

Also, get a quote from numerous buyers to see if you’re being lowballed for your trade.
